RMIC is a national, private mortgage insurer based in Winston-Salem, N.C. RMIC's private mortgage insurance coverage allows lenders to approve mortgage loans with smaller down payments, making home buying more affordable. RMIC offers mortgage lenders an array of innovative products including ZIP(SM) Monthlies, OASIS(SM), contract underwriting, Electronic Loan Submission, customer training, quality control services, and affordable housing programs.
